  7. akan7

    akan7 Member

    Hi, it's does show audio format details, you just have to add.

    (DTS-X) = Badge
    (TrueHD Atmos) = Dolby Atmos badge

    If you add a description in the filename, it will then add that badge to your movie.

    <movie name> (TrueHD Atmos) = Dolby Atmos badge
    etc...
    Black Hawk Down (UHD-HEVC)(TrueHD Atmos).mkv
    • (4K) = 4K badge
    • (3D-AVC) = 3D+H.264 badge
    • (UHD-HEVC) = 4K+H.265 HEVC badge
    • (AVC) = H.264 badge
    • (HEVC) = H.265 HEVC badge
    • (AVC) = H.254 MPEG-4/AVC badge
    • (DTS-HD MA 5.1/7.1) = DTS-HD High Resolution Audio badge Dolby
    • (TrueHD) = TrueHD badge
    • (Dolby) = Dolby Digital badge
    • (DTS) = DTS badge
    • .iso = ISO badge
    • .mkv = MKV badge

  10. Markswift2003

    Markswift2003 Well-Known Member SUPER Administrator Beta test group Contributor

    Ok, this behaviour is expected if you know the logic.

    Firstly, "DTS" is a reserved string for file suffixes to identify codecs.

    Then, "demo" also seems to be a reserved string, but I'm not sure why - probably in the same vein as "trailer".

    So the order in which these appear in the filename is important to identify the file as valid.

    If you omit the reserved strings, and simply name the file "2019 Disc Vol.23.iso" HT2 finds it straight away and isn't even bothered about the numeric string at the start.

  17. Markswift2003

    Markswift2003 Well-Known Member SUPER Administrator Beta test group Contributor

    Zidoo Poster v2.9.28

    https://mega.nz/file/BSpzkSZT#MfaslXlBklTQvERK7XV_hdA6u30sEvm2kmrimc6SAcU

    Changelog:

    1. Increase the viewing history of recently, added forced time reverse display
    2. Optimize the title recognition, compatible with the "season x. Episode xx" video
    3. When adding to the collection, focus control of the collection list
    4. Solve the problem of possible crash when scanning occasionally
    5. Automatically categorized collection movies, adding "Remove Collection" function
    6. Optimized movie added to the collection function
    7. Movie category added to the left column of the home page
    8. The movie details interface adds a trailer function (can be turned off in the settings)
    9. Optimize the display of the new collection of personalized pictures
    10. Solve the problem that the pictures of Douban matching movies are not clear
    11.Optimize the function of getting local pictures automatically if the movie has no poster when the priority local picture switch is turned off
    12. Rematch and add poster preview function
    13. Solve the problem that the details entered by NFO will occasionally crash
    14. When the child lock password protection is turned off, the main interface will no longer display the lock icon
    15. Solve the problem that movies with the same title in different years will be matched into the same movie
    16. Added CLEARLOGO function in the detail interface
    17. Increase the function of Pop-up button of remote control
    18. Solve the problem that "scanning" is always displayed when adding devices
    19. Solve the problem that the change of poster language does not take effect
    20. Optimized sorting function
    21. Priority search for TMDb during smart search
    22. Optimize child lock function

  20. Markswift2003

    Markswift2003 Well-Known Member SUPER Administrator Beta test group Contributor

    My guess is the root of the problem is because Sources are not specifically defined as either a TV Source or Movie Source in the first place - they're just sources.

    So when the scraper is initially called, it has no way of knowing whether it's a TV series or Movie at that point.

    I'd expect some logic could be written in at the initial lookup which then says if it's a TV series use TVDB, else use TMDB...
